Coca-Cola Delivers This Monster Jolt To 'Exclusive' Energy-Drink Partner

Monster Beverage[ticker symb=MNST] shares dropped after Coca-Cola[ticker symb=KO] revealed it's developing its own energy drinks which could compete with the brand. The soft drink behemoth had touted the smaller firm as its "exclusive energy play" when it agreed in 2014 to take a 16.7% equity stake in the energy drink maker as part of a distribution partnership.
